Category 6A is highly recommended for all new commercial installations to support 10 Gbps speeds and higher Power over Ethernet (PoE) wattages. Category 6 and Category 5e remain recognized but are less ideal for future-proofing.
Wideband Multimode Fiber (OM5) is fully integrated into the standard, allowing for short-wavelength division multiplexing (SWDM) to transmit multiple signals over a single pair of fibers. TIA-568

ANSI/TIA-568.1-E, titled "Commercial Building Telecommunications Infrastructure Standard," is part of the larger TIA-568 series.
